Practice reading and writing AB word family words with these phonics dice games. Students will roll the dice then color, trace or write the target word. These games are differentiated for students who need more support can be successful as well. These games make great literacy centers or phonics stations.
Skills Assessed
Blending Onset and Rime
Reading CVC Words
Writing CVC Words
Spelling CVC Words
Ways to Use:
Use the tracing pages to trace the word rolled (single player)
Use the grid pages to color the word rolled (single player)
Create a graph by rolling the dice X number of times and then filling in the blank grid squares. (single player)
Three in a Row: Using the grid paper with words, students take turns rolling the dice and coloring the words in the grid. The first player with 3 words in a row wins. (partner game)

AB Word Family Sorting Activities
$2.00
Need a fun hands on way to practice reading and recognizing AB words? These sorting activities provide a great way to practice these word family in an engaging literacy center.
There are three different sorting activities to practice learning to read and recognize AB family words.
Sorts Include
Sort words that are part of the AB family from words that are not part of the AB family.
Sort pictures that are part of the AB family from pictures that are not part of the AB family.
Sort between real and nonsense AB words.
These low prep sorting activities are easy to create. Simply print the pages, cut out the sorting cards and laminate if desired. By laminating this literacy activity can be used over and over if laminated.
